The author has reported the possibility to use venation for identification of tortricids. In the previous paper (Liu 1996), an expert system for identification using venation was also described. The present paper introduces the technique how to construct the expert system. Three original solutions in the research are published. They are: establishment of corrdinates of venation—“two‐centre method”, the interface to accept inputs—“model modification method” and the interface to generate outputs—“sequence method”.
